A new leak suggests that a major manufacturer could be testing an ambitious camera setup for its next flagship smartphone.
According to the well-known tipster Digital Chat Station on Weibo, an upcoming flagship handset may feature a 100-megapixel selfie camera. If true, this would make it one of the highest-resolution front cameras ever seen on a mainstream smartphone.
The report suggests that the device could use a custom small-pixel sensor for the front camera. Typically, high-resolution selfie cameras are paired with pixel-binning technology. This allows the sensor to merge multiple pixels into a single larger pixel, improving light capture and enhancing low-light performance while maintaining manageable sensor size constraints.
However, the tipster also cautions that the sensor is currently in early testing. As such, there remains a possibility that the hardware specifications could change before the final product launch.
In addition to the 100MP selfie camera, the mystery flagship is said to feature two 200-megapixel rear sensors. While the exact roles of these cameras have not been detailed, a dual 200MP configuration could theoretically help preserve high levels of detail across different focal lengths. This approach would reduce reliance on digital cropping and potentially deliver sharper results in both standard and zoom photography.
The leak does not mention the presence of additional rear cameras. That said, Ultra-branded flagship smartphones typically include at least one ultrawide sensor to round out the camera system.
Although the tipster did not directly name the brand behind the device, comments on the Weibo post suggest that it could be an Oppo smartphone.
Interestingly, another recent report mentioned that two 200-megapixel camera sensors are being tested for use in a compact 6.3-inch flagship device. While the handset was not explicitly identified, it is widely believed to be the Xiaomi 18 Pro.
So, in short, the identity of the flagship smartphone in discussion here remains unclear as of now. All we can say for now is that if these leaks prove accurate, the smartphone could set new standards in mobile photography.
